Living Tour 2023: Marc Anthony announces concert at the National Stadium for December

Puerto Rican singer Marc Anthony will return to Peru on December 12 to present his “Viviendo Tour 2023” tour at the National Stadium.

The concert will feature the participation of national artists Deyvis Orosco and Mauricio Mesones, as well as an international guest who will be announced soon.

Ticket pre-sale will begin on September 25 on the Ticketmaster website. The event is produced by FyM Entertainment.

successes like Live my life, What a price heaven has, Your love does me good, And there was someone, Now who, Live ours, I know you well and many more will be chanted by the entire public that comes to the National Stadium.

Marc Anthony returns after receiving a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ame that celebrates his career and the decades of musical work that have positioned him as one of the most prominent Latin salsa artists.

With more than 50 number one hits on the Billboard charts, he does not hesitate to recognize that he owes his success to that audience that has always been at his side, supporting him and filling the great stages he has visited throughout his career.
